Output 63f0a91accaca509e7a96fb6ea237b2c898d7e7e14d6f369cb55f0542ab6ee64:103

value
9852647
script pubkey
OP_0 OP_PUSHBYTES_20 3925d108a04421e14f407202eb984a39cdda354e
address
bc1q8yjazz9qgss7zn6qwgpwhxz288xa5d2wjwhu4d
transaction
63f0a91accaca509e7a96fb6ea237b2c898d7e7e14d6f369cb55f0542ab6ee64
confirmations
270019
spent
true